| career roles | key responsibilities |
|---|---|
| grant writer | research funding opportunities, draft proposals, collaborate with teams |
| nonprofit program manager | oversee grant-funded programs, ensure compliance, report outcomes |
| fundraising coordinator | identify donors, manage grant applications, track funding progress |
| research administrator | manage grant budgets, ensure regulatory compliance, coordinate submissions |
| development officer | cultivate donor relationships, write grant proposals, secure funding |
| grant compliance specialist | monitor grant requirements, ensure adherence to guidelines, prepare audits |
| proposal development consultant | provide expertise in proposal writing, review submissions, offer strategic advice |
